Marrakech - Ait Ben Haddou. 200 Km

Leaving Marrakech, the ascent to the Tichka Pass begins on a winding, panoramic road, revealing craggy peaks and verdant valleys. On the way down, a diversion to Telouet allows you to visit the famous Kasbah du Glaoui, an ancient building combining history and Berber architecture, nestled in the heart of the mountains. Continuing on to Aït Ben Haddou, the route passes through small villages and colourful landscapes before reaching this emblematic fortified village, a World Heritage site. The arrival in Ouarzazate brings this day rich in discovery to a close, offering a final glimpse of the spectacular landscapes and historic sites of southern Morocco.

Boumalne Dadès - Erfoud. 290 Km

We leave Boumalne Dades to explore the spectacular Dades Gorges before looping through the High Atlas towards the dramatic Todra Gorges. From towering cliffs and winding mountain roads to the vast landscapes around Erfoud, we finish our southern adventure in the heart of Morocco’s desert country.

Erfoud - Aguelmam. 270 Km

We leave the south, heading north. Passing through the palm groves of Erfoud, and the breathtaking panoramas of the Ziz valley. After a break in Errachidia, the road climbs towards the Middle Atlas Mountains, offering breathtaking views before arriving at Aguelmam Lake at the end of the day, where we'll settle into a superb lakeside resort.

Aguelmam - Azrou. 260 Km

The route continues through the mountainous landscapes of Ito, offering panoramic views of the Middle Atlas plateaux, before arriving in Azrou, renowned for its cedar forests and thousands of cherry trees.

Azrou - Binelouidane. 270 Km

We leave the cedar forests of Ain Leuh and head towards Khénifra along the Oum Er-Rbia river. After a break in Afourer, the road winds through the Middle Atlas Mountains, offering panoramic views before reaching the Bin El Ouidane lake and its spectacular dam (one of the largest in the kingdom).

Binelouidane - Marrakech. 230 Km

A final day on the bike before heading back to Marrakech. We leave the lake behind to reach the Ouzoud waterfalls for a coffee break with a view of the impressive falls (100m). We then leave the heights of the Atlas for good to reach the plains of El Haouz. We say goodbye to our mounts and return to the hustle and bustle of the Ochre city. The evening ends with a closing dinner where music and gastronomy are king. A final magical Moroccan evening.
